INSTALLATION AND CONNECTIONS Inserting the micro SIM card Before performing the steps below, make sure that the module is disconnected from the mains power. Insert the micro SIM card in the relevant slot. Attaching the antenna Connect the antenna to the relevant connector on the module. Use the extension cable for remote control of the antenna. To improve the antenna reception, use a metal support as shown.

Managing the system Creating users (Address book) You can now manage the system you have created. In the [Address book] section, add single entry-panel users and their phone numbers. A specific [Dial-to-open action] can be assigned to each contact. With the [Dial-to-open action], every time a user calls the entry panel phone number, the indicated actions are performed.
Managing units Under [Unit management], create the units to be associated with the entry-panel call buttons. The units are made up of one or more contacts in the [Address book]. When a call button is pressed, the entry panel calls the first number that was added to the unit.

Call forwarding to voicemail function This function allows the MTMA/CONNECT to distinguish between the user answering and the voicemail activating. When the voicemail is activated for the number called, the user is considered to be unavailable and the call is forwarded to the next recipient in the unit list.
